--The P-51 Mustang is a reciprocating single-engine single-seat fighter developed in the United States and operated by the United States Army Air Forces, etc., and was described as the best fighter during World War II.
――The initial production type equipped with the Allison engine lacked high altitude performance, but the B / C type equipped with the Marlin engine overwhelmed the same generation aircraft in terms of speed, high altitude performance, and cruising range.
――In addition, the D type uses a bubble canopy to solve the problem of poor rear visibility.
--The K type is a model equipped with a machined aluminum propeller manufactured by Aero Products.
